In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

virtio-net: free xsk_buffs on error in virtnet_xsk_pool_enable()

The selftests added to our CI by Bui Quang Minh recently reveals
that there is a mem leak on the error path of virtnet_xsk_pool_enable():

unreferenced object 0xffff88800a68a000 (size 2048):
  comm "xdp_helper", pid 318, jiffies 4294692778
  hex dump (first 32 bytes):
    00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00  ................
    00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00 00  ................
  backtrace (crc 0):
    __kvmalloc_node_noprof+0x402/0x570
    virtnet_xsk_pool_enable+0x293/0x6a0 (drivers/net/virtio_net.c:5882)
    xp_assign_dev+0x369/0x670 (net/xdp/xsk_buff_pool.c:226)
    xsk_bind+0x6a5/0x1ae0
    __sys_bind+0x15e/0x230
    __x64_sys_bind+0x72/0xb0
    do_syscall_64+0xc1/0x1d0
    entry_SYSCALL_64_after_hwframe+0x77/0x7f
